GWX 1.2 1939 is this really that easy..?
 
Not sure but maybe there's something wrong with my install. Everything is running ok but i'm in 1939 and I can sink anything that goes by with out a problem. Destroyers go right by me and gun boats just run around me and speed off....strange, nobody will attack. If I fire a shot at them they do then attack but be for that it's like we are not at war. Is there something wrong with my install..? thanks for any info.:roll:

Sailor Steve 05-10-08 12:15 AM

GWX 2.1 lets you start in August 1939 if you want to. The war doesn't start until September.:yep:

Sailor Steve 05-10-08 12:37 AM

:yep:

You'll get radio messages telling you to attack Polish traffic on September 1, and British and French on September 3. Until GWX 2.1 the start date was always September 1. The August start date mainly lets you be one of the boats that was sent out to be on station when the war began, so you don't have to cross the Evil Channel during wartime.:sunny:
